Being able to talk about the weather in English can benefit you during a lot of conversations. For example, you might like to talk about travel and holidays and explain what the weather was like, or you might like to discuss upcoming weather in conjunction with any plans you are making (is it going to rain when you plan to go to the beach, for example?) Being able to recognise weather words will also help you to understand English weather forecasts which can come in extremely handy.

Weather Vocabulary

Weather is the state of the atmosphere, describing for example the degree to which it is hot or cold, wet or dry, calm or stormy, clear or cloudy.

Useful Weather Words & Weather Terms

Weather Vocabulary Words List

Sun

  • Bright – The weather was bright and sunny.
  • Blazing – The sun was blazing down that afternoon.
  • Sunlight – I was dazzled by the sunlight.
  • Sunshine – It was a cool day with fitful sunshine.

Rain

  • Drizzling– It’s been drizzling all day.
  • Pouring – It was absolutely pouring with rain.
  • Raining – It is raining cats and dogs.
  • Lashing – The rain was lashing the windows.

Clouds

  • Cloudy – It was so cloudy that the top of the mountain was invisible.
  • Gloomy – It was a wet and gloomy day.
  • Foggy – It was foggy and the sun shone feebly through the murk.
  • Overcast – The sky was soon overcast.
  • Clear – His visit came out of a clear sky.

Fog

  • Mist – The sun will evaporate the mist.
  • Haze – The sun was surrounded by a golden haze.
  • Dense fog – The airport was closed in by the dense fog.
  • Patchy fog – Drizzle and patchy fog are forecast.

Snow

  • Snowfall – There was very little snowfall last year.
  • Sleet – The rain was turning to sleet.
  • Snowstorm – The snowstorm will last till tomorrow afternoon.
  • Snowflake – A single snowflake landed on her nose.
  • Blizzard – Eleanor arrived in the midst of a blizzard.

Wind

  • Breeze – A cold breeze was blowing hard.
  • Blustery – The day was cold and blustery.
  • Windy – It was windy and Jake felt cold.
  • Windstorm – The sea was choppy today because of the windstorm.
  • Hurricane – A hurricane hit the city yesterday at 5 p.m.

Temperature

  • Hot – The weather was hot, without a breath of wind.
  • Warm – It is nice and warm today.
  • Cool – It was a lovely cool evening.
  • Cold – The cold weather exhilarated the walkers.
  • Freezing – It is freezing cold now.

Natural Disasters

  • Landslide – The railroad was blocked by a landslide.
  • Avalanche – They were killed by an avalanche in the Swiss Alps.
  • Storm – The weather forecast is for severe storms tonight.
  • Drought – They are preparing against a drought.
  • Earthquake – We had an awful earthquake last week.
